Property is moderate renovation needed.
Built in 1954, this mid-century home is well-maintained but significantly dated. While the flooring has been updated, the kitchen features older cabinetry and tile countertops, and the interior includes dated wallpaper and fixtures. It is functional and move-in ready but requires cosmetic and likely system updates to meet modern standards.
